Output f6668025cadf44e776bfb538346ab31237d0ed08f2a6917e150fdc5e5f37e40c:45

value
384269
script pubkey
OP_0 OP_PUSHBYTES_20 18371899f3dbfa3ebb52cbcfaa2c7e3208bf1a5b
address
bc1qrqm33x0nm0araw6je0865tr7xgyt7xjm9ugzgt
transaction
f6668025cadf44e776bfb538346ab31237d0ed08f2a6917e150fdc5e5f37e40c